Serviced Office in Slough

115 Serviced Offices available in Slough
Or call us at wifi_calling_3 020 3808 7222
Serviced Office in Slough, Berkshire United Kingdom
meeting_roomAvailable Offices 128 Offices
chairCapacity 1 - 130 Desks
monetization_onPrice Range (Month)£141 to £13,500
monetization_onAVG Desk Price (Month)£265
If you're in search of a Serviced Office in Slough, Berkshire, look no further. With a whopping 146 available spaces, you can find the perfect office to suit your needs. Whether you're a solo entrepreneur or a team of 125, the monthly prices range from as low as $304 to $38547. This provides flexibility for businesses of all sizes and budgets. With this wide range of options, the perfect office space is within reach, right here in Slough.

Why Your Business Should Choose a Serviced Office in Slough, Berkshire

Slough, Berkshire, United Kingdom, is a vibrant and dynamic town located in close proximity to the bustling city of London. Known for its thriving economy and diverse business community, Slough offers a range of opportunities for entrepreneurs and established businesses alike. The town's strategic location and excellent transport links make it a desirable destination for companies looking to establish a presence in the region.
For businesses seeking a convenient and flexible office solution in Slough, serviced offices provide an ideal option. These fully equipped and professionally managed workspaces offer a range of amenities and services, allowing businesses to focus on their core operations without the hassle of managing office infrastructure.
With 146 available serviced office spaces in Slough, businesses can choose from a variety of options to suit their specific needs. The average cost per desk is 486, making serviced offices a cost-effective solution for companies of all sizes. In addition, there are also 10 available virtual spaces and 18 available coworking spaces, providing even more flexibility for businesses looking for alternative office arrangements.
Whether seeking a private office space or a shared collaborative environment, Slough's serviced offices cater to a diverse range of business requirements. As the town continues to evolve as a hub for innovation and entrepreneurship, serviced offices offer a convenient and practical solution for businesses looking to thrive in this dynamic environment.

Why Choose Office Hub?

Dedicated account managers

Best deal guarantee

Best deal guarantee

Dedicated account managers

100% free of charge

100% free of charge